Center Moriches leans Republican by roughly 22 points: about 39% of voters vote Democratic and 61% Republican.
About 83% of adults in Center Moriches typically vote, above the U.S. average of about 62%. Among adults in Center Moriches, ~32% vote Democratic, ~51% Republican, and ~17% don't vote. The map below shows estimated turnout by block group.
How Center Moriches compares
Among cities within 25 miles, Center Moriches leans more Republican than 66 of 89 neighbors.
Center Moriches runs about 35 points more Republican than New York as a whole. New York leans Democratic overall, while Center Moriches is one of the few Republican-leaning pockets.
Why Center Moriches leans the way it does
This analysis examined 14,881 data points per city to find what predicts political lean and turnout. The items below are a few correlations that stood out for Center Moriches, not a ranked or complete list of what matters most.
Center Moriches votes Republican even though it is densely developed (about 76%, far above the New York average of 36%). State and regional patterns outweigh the Democratic lean that density usually predicts here. A high family-household share predicts Republican voting, and about 79% of households in Center Moriches are family households, above 88% of cities. Center Moriches runs against the grain of New York, a Republican-leaning pocket in a Democratic-leaning state.
Walkability and Democratic lean
Places with a highly walkable street grid tend to lean Democratic; Center Moriches, NY sits in the top quarter nationally on this measure. A walkable street grid does not change how people vote; it mostly reflects how urban a place is.
Why turnout in Center Moriches looks the way it does
Homeowners vote more often than renters. About 91% of households in Center Moriches own their home, about 14 points above the New York average of 76%. Learn more about the findings and methodology on the political spectrum map.

Sources and methodology
Precinct-level voting records used to fit the model come from New York State Board of Elections, distributed by the Voting and Election Science Team. Demographic inputs come from the U.S. Census Bureau (ACS 5-year estimates and the 2020 Decennial Census). Health and environmental inputs come from the CDC (PLACES and the Environmental Justice Index). Land cover comes from the USGS and EPA. Election-day and lead-up weather come from PRISM 4km daily grids and the NOAA Global Historical Climatology Network. Mail-voting and election-administration patterns come from the MIT Election Lab's Survey of the Performance of American Elections. Block-group crime detail comes from CrimeGrade.
